Tesla produces 100 millionth battery cell, here’s what it means

Tesla has announced that it produced its 100 millionth 4680 battery cell. Here’s what it means for its production growth. The 4680 battery cell is a new format, 46mm x 80mm, enabled by a few new technologies that Tesla announced at Battery Day in 2020. Kia and Honda’s massive incentives spark a surge in EV registrations in July

Several EV models sold with over $10,000 in incentives in July, driving registrations up 18% from last year in the US. Kia’s new EV9 was among the most heavily discounted, selling with over $19,700 in incentives. Other models, like the Honda Prologue and Volkswagen ID.4, were also heavily discounted, which helped spark growth.
